Определения

devourглагол
To eat something eagerly and in large amounts so that nothing is left.
The hungry children devoured the pizza within minutes.
To read or look at something with great interest and enthusiasm.
She devoured the novel in one sitting, unable to put it down.
To destroy or consume something completely, as if by eating; to engulf.
The flames devoured the entire building in a matter of hours.
To overwhelm or consume (a person) with an intense emotion.
He was devoured by guilt after lying to his parents.
